A farmaceutische isolator, also known as a pharmaceutical isolator, is a sealed enclosure that is used to handle hazardous materials and protect the products being manufactured from contamination. These isolators are designed to provide a controlled environment with low levels of contaminants, such as dust, particles, and microorganisms, to ensure the sterility of pharmaceutical products.
One of the primary purposes of a farmaceutische isolator is to prevent cross-contamination between different products or batches. In pharmaceutical manufacturing, it is crucial to maintain the purity and integrity of the products being produced. Cross-contamination can occur when hazardous materials from one product come into contact with another, leading to potential safety risks and product quality issues. By using a farmaceutische isolator, pharmaceutical manufacturers can effectively isolate different processes and materials, reducing the risk of cross-contamination.
Another key benefit of using a farmaceutische isolator is the protection it provides to operators and personnel working in pharmaceutical manufacturing facilities. Many pharmaceutical products contain hazardous materials that can be harmful if they come into contact with skin or are inhaled. By using a pharmaceutical isolator, operators are shielded from these hazardous materials, reducing their exposure and ensuring their safety.
farmaceutische isolators also play a crucial role in maintaining the sterility of pharmaceutical products. In pharmaceutical manufacturing, it is essential to produce products that are free from contamination to ensure their quality and safety. Pharmaceutical isolators provide a controlled environment with low levels of contaminants, such as bacteria, viruses, and fungi, to prevent the growth of microorganisms that can compromise product sterility.
Furthermore, farmaceutische isolators are designed to meet strict regulatory requirements and standards set forth by organizations such as the FDA and EMA. These regulatory bodies require pharmaceutical manufacturers to implement measures to ensure the safety, quality, and efficacy of their products. By using a pharmaceutical isolator, manufacturers can demonstrate their commitment to compliance with these regulations and ensure that their products meet the necessary standards.
In addition to their role in ensuring product quality and safety, farmaceutische isolators also contribute to efficiency and productivity in pharmaceutical manufacturing. Pharmaceutical isolators are equipped with features such as glove ports, airlocks, and pressure differentials, which allow operators to perform tasks efficiently while maintaining the integrity of the controlled environment. These features help streamline processes, reduce the risk of errors, and improve overall productivity in pharmaceutical manufacturing facilities.
